在數字化時代,建立個人或企業(yè)網站已成為展示信息、服務和產品的重要途徑。無論是新手還是資深開發(fā)者,選擇合適的軟件工具對于創(chuàng)建和維護一個高效、吸引人的網站至關重要。本文將探討構建網站時需要的軟件類別和具體推薦。
1. 網頁設計與開發(fā)工具
HTML/CSS編輯器
- Visual Studio Code: 一款免費、開源的文本編輯器,支持多種編程語言的語法高亮和智能提示功能,非常適合前端開發(fā)。
- Sublime Text: 另一個流行的輕量級文本編輯器,以其速度和簡潔性著稱。
集成開發(fā)環(huán)境(IDE)
- WebStorm: JetBrains出品的強大IDE,特別針對JavaScript和相關技術棧優(yōu)化,提供代碼補全、導航和重構等功能。
- Atom: 由GitHub開發(fā)的開源文本編輯器,可通過安裝包擴展來支持多種編程語言和開發(fā)框架。
2. 內容管理系統(tǒng)(CMS)
如果你希望快速搭建網站而不想深入代碼層面,使用CMS是明智之選:
- WordPress: 世界上最流行的自建網站平臺之一,適合博客、企業(yè)網站等各類站點建設。豐富的插件庫讓定制化變得簡單快捷。
- Joomla!: 另一款廣受歡迎的開源CMS系統(tǒng),適用于更復雜或具有特定需求的網站項目。
3. 圖形設計軟件
為了美化你的網站界面,你還需要一些優(yōu)秀的設計工具:
- Adobe Photoshop: 圖像處理領域里的標桿產品,能夠制作高質量的視覺元素如Logo、按鈕圖標等。
- Sketch: Mac用戶常用的UI/UX設計應用程序,專注于界面布局與交互原型的設計流程。
4. 版本控制系統(tǒng)
團隊協(xié)作過程中不可或缺的一部分就是版本控制:
- Git: 分布式版本控制系統(tǒng),允許多個開發(fā)者同時工作于同一個項目的不同部分而不相互干擾。配合GitHub/GitLab等平臺使用效果更佳。
- SVN (Subversion): 另一種廣泛采用的版本管理解決方案,雖然比Git稍顯老舊但仍有其忠實用戶群。
5. 性能測試與分析工具
確保你的網站運行流暢并擁有良好的用戶體驗同樣重要:
- Google PageSpeed Insights: 谷歌提供的在線服務,可以評估頁面加載速度及給出改進建議。
- GTmetrix: 類似于PageSpeed Insights的工具,還額外提供了歷史記錄比較功能幫助跟蹤進度變化。
從編碼到設計再到部署上線后的監(jiān)控維護,每一步都有相應的專業(yè)軟件可供選擇。根據實際需求和個人偏好挑選合適的組合,就能有效地提升工作效率并創(chuàng)造出令人印象深刻的作品。